HFD vs. SMWH, CURY, PETS, MOON, APGN, CARD, FDL, STU, SCS, and MRK
Should you be buying Halfords Group stock or one of its competitors? The main competitors of Halfords Group include WH Smith (SMWH), Currys (CURY), Pets at Home Group (PETS), Moonpig Group (MOON), Applegreen (APGN), Card Factory (CARD), Findel (FDL), Studio Retail Group (STU), ScS Group (SCS), and Marks Electrical Group (MRK). These companies are all part of the "specialty retail" industry.

Halfords Group (LON:HFD) and WH Smith (LON:SMWH) are both small-cap consumer cyclical companies, but which is the superior investment? We will compare the two businesses based on the strength of their media sentiment, valuation, earnings, profitability, community ranking, dividends, risk, analyst recommendations and institutional ownership.
Halfords Group received 119 more outperform votes than WH Smith when rated by MarketBeat users. Likewise, 66.37% of users gave Halfords Group an outperform vote while only 62.55% of users gave WH Smith an outperform vote.
Halfords Group pays an annual dividend of GBX 8 per share and has a dividend yield of 5.1%. WH Smith pays an annual dividend of GBX 32 per share and has a dividend yield of 3.5%. Halfords Group pays out 120.8% of its earnings in the form of a dividend, suggesting it may not have sufficient earnings to cover its dividend payment in the future. WH Smith pays out 66.0% of its earnings in the form of a dividend.
91.3% of Halfords Group shares are held by institutional investors. Comparatively, 91.2% of WH Smith shares are held by institutional investors. 2.3% of Halfords Group shares are held by insiders. Comparatively, 1.2% of WH Smith shares are held by insiders. Strong institutional ownership is an indication that hedge funds, large money managers and endowments believe a stock is poised for long-term growth.
WH Smith has a net margin of 3.44% compared to Halfords Group's net margin of 0.85%. WH Smith's return on equity of 17.78% beat Halfords Group's return on equity.
Halfords Group presently has a consensus price target of GBX 148.50, suggesting a potential downside of 6.01%. WH Smith has a consensus price target of GBX 1,456.67, suggesting a potential upside of 59.46%. Given WH Smith's stronger consensus rating and higher probable upside, analysts plainly believe WH Smith is more favorable than Halfords Group.
WH Smith has higher revenue and earnings than Halfords Group. WH Smith is trading at a lower price-to-earnings ratio than Halfords Group, indicating that it is currently the more affordable of the two stocks.
Halfords Group has a beta of 1.62, indicating that its share price is 62% more volatile than the S&P 500. Comparatively, WH Smith has a beta of 1.67, indicating that its share price is 67% more volatile than the S&P 500.
In the previous week, Halfords Group and Halfords Group both had 1 articles in the media. Halfords Group's average media sentiment score of 0.00 beat WH Smith's score of -0.10 indicating that Halfords Group is being referred to more favorably in the media.
Summary
WH Smith beats Halfords Group on 12 of the 19 factors compared between the two stocks.
